diff --git a/core/assets/bundles/bundle_ru.properties b/core/assets/bundles/bundle_ru.properties index 237f291182..1e7f7d02af 100644 --- a/core/assets/bundles/bundle_ru.properties +++ b/core/assets/bundles/bundle_ru.properties @@ -149,15 +149,15 @@ mod.incompatiblemod = [red]Несовместимый mod.blacklisted = [red]Неподдерживаемый mod.unmetdependencies = [red]Не найдены зависимости mod.erroredcontent = [scarlet]Ошибки содержимого -mod.circulardependencies = [red]Circular Dependencies -mod.incompletedependencies = [red]Incomplete Dependencies +mod.circulardependencies = [red]Цикличные зависимости +mod.incompletedependencies = [red]Недопустимые или отсутствующие зависимости mod.requiresversion.details = Требуется версия игры: [accent]{0}[]\nВаша игра устарела. Для работы этого мода требуется более новая версия игры (возможно, альфа/бета-версия). mod.outdatedv7.details = Этот мод несовместим с последней версией игры. Автор должен обновить его и добавить [accent]minGameVersion: 136[] в файл [accent]mod.json[]. mod.blacklisted.details = Этот мод был вручную занесен в черный список из-за того, что он вызывал сбои или другие проблемы с текущей версией игры. Не используйте его. mod.missingdependencies.details = Для этого мода отсутствуют зависимости: {0} mod.erroredcontent.details = Этот мод вызвал ошибки при загрузке. Попросите автора мода исправить их. -mod.circulardependencies.details = This mod has dependencies that depends on each other. -mod.incompletedependencies.details = This mod is unable to be loaded due to invalid or missing dependencies: {0}. +mod.circulardependencies.details = Этот мод имеет зависимости, которые зависят друг от друга. +mod.incompletedependencies.details = Этот мод не может быть загружен из-за недопустимых или отсутствующих зависимостей: {0}. mod.requiresversion = Требуется версия игры: [red]{0} mod.errors = Ошибки были вызваны загружаемым содержимым. @@ -335,7 +335,7 @@ command.repair = Ремонтировать command.rebuild = Восстанавливать command.assist = Помогать игроку command.move = Двигаться -command.boost = Boost +command.boost = Подняться openlink = Открыть ссылку copylink = Скопировать ссылку back = Назад diff --git a/core/src/mindustry/world/blocks/environment/Floor.java b/core/src/mindustry/world/blocks/environment/Floor.java index 843ef51f6b..56c7625f44 100644 --- a/core/src/mindustry/world/blocks/environment/Floor.java +++ b/core/src/mindustry/world/blocks/environment/Floor.java @@ -161,6 +161,8 @@ public class Floor extends Block{ return; } + if(Core.atlas.has(name + "-edge")) return; + var image = Core.atlas.getPixmap(icons()[0]); var edge = Core.atlas.getPixmap(Core.atlas.find(name + "-edge-stencil", "edge-stencil")); Pixmap result = new Pixmap(edge.width, edge.height); diff --git a/core/src/mindustry/world/blocks/payloads/PayloadLoader.java b/core/src/mindustry/world/blocks/payloads/PayloadLoader.java index 6d46013484..6f1b6cf9d6 100644 --- a/core/src/mindustry/world/blocks/payloads/PayloadLoader.java +++ b/core/src/mindustry/world/blocks/payloads/PayloadLoader.java @@ -5,6 +5,7 @@ import arc.graphics.g2d.*; import arc.math.*; import arc.util.*; import arc.util.io.*; +import mindustry.annotations.Annotations.*; import mindustry.entities.units.*; import mindustry.gen.*; import mindustry.graphics.*; @@ -23,6 +24,8 @@ public class PayloadLoader extends PayloadBlock{ public float maxPowerConsumption = 40f; public boolean loadPowerDynamic = true; + public @Load("@-over") TextureRegion overRegion; + //initialized in init(), do not touch protected float basePowerUse = 0f; @@ -132,6 +135,11 @@ public class PayloadLoader extends PayloadBlock{ Draw.z(Layer.blockOver); drawPayload(); + + if(overRegion.found()){ + Draw.z(Layer.blockOver + 0.1f); + Draw.rect(overRegion, x, y); + } } @Override diff --git a/servers_v7.json b/servers_v7.json index 44ae10eae5..ddc33289bf 100644 --- a/servers_v7.json +++ b/servers_v7.json @@ -101,7 +101,8 @@ }, { "name": "OMNIDUSTRY", - "address": ["92.255.104.225", "92.255.104.225:6568", "92.255.104.225:6569", "92.255.104.225:6570", "92.255.104.225:6571", "92.255.104.225:6572", "92.255.104.225:6573", "92.255.104.225:6574"] + "address": ["85.193.87.179", "85.193.87.179:6568", "85.193.87.179:6569", "85.193.87.179:6570", "85.193.87.179:6571", "85.193.87.179:6572", "85.193.87.179:6573", "85.193.87.179:6574"] + }, { "name": "The Devil",